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Blogmentor – Blog Layouts for Elementor versions n/a through 1.5
Description The issue is related to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ation, also known as Cross-site Scripting (XSS). This allows for Stored XSS, which can be exploited.
Recommendations For versions n/a through 1.5, as a temporary workaround, consider disabling any features that allow user input in web page generation until a patch is available. Restrict access to sensitive areas of the Blogmentor – Blog Layouts for Elementor to minimize the risk of exploitation. Avoid using the plugin until the issue is resolved.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
